The doors of Audi A6 are made of steel plates, not aluminum alloy. Only specific models like RS6, RS4, and A8 feature an all-aluminum body. Audi A6 body size configuration: The length, width, and height of the Audi A6 are 5038x1886x1475mm. Audi A6 powertrain configuration: The Audi A6 offers a choice between a 2.0-liter turbocharged engine and a 3.0-liter turbocharged engine. The 2.0-liter low-power version has a maximum horsepower of 190, the 2.0-liter high-power version reaches 224 horsepower, and the 3.0-liter version delivers a maximum of 340 horsepower.
